OCS is seeking a General Maintenance Engineer in Greater London to ensure efficient delivery of facilities management services. Key responsibilities include directing Reactive Works and supporting overall service delivery, all while adhering to safety standards.
The ideal candidate will have time-served experience in maintenance, including Carpentry and minor plumbing works. The role offers a dynamic work environment with a focus on safety and effective service delivery.
